A new artificial intelligence system developed by researchers has demonstrated superior accuracy in short-term weather forecasting compared to conventional physics-based models. The AI model, trained on decades of historical weather data, can predict precipitation, temperature, and severe weather events up to 10 days in advance with greater precision. Early operational tests show it reduces error rates by approximately 20% for key metrics like hurricane track prediction. While promising, meteorologists note that integrating AI forecasts with established methods will be crucial for reliability.
